Most Popular Iowa Schools for an Award Taking 1 to 4 Years in Communications Technology/Support
Our 2023 rankings named Western Iowa Tech Community College the most popular school in Iowa for communications technologies and support students working on their undergraduate certificate. Western Iowa Tech Community College is a moderately-sized public school located in the small city of Sioux City.
About 45% of the students majoring in communications technologies and support at the school are women while 55% are male.
